• MARKETCAP
  • BLOG
  • Policy
Web3Insights
  • Bitcoin
  • Cryptocurrency
  • DeFi
  • Web3
  • NFTs
  • Markets
  • Tutorials
  • Data insights
Reading: Building AI Agents for Web3: A Step-by-Step Guide
Share

  • bitcoinBitcoin(BTC)$103,283.00
  • ethereumEthereum(ETH)$2,532.52
  • tetherTether(USDT)$1.00
  • rippleXRP(XRP)$2.44
  • binancecoinBNB(BNB)$651.30
  • solanaSolana(SOL)$169.66
  • usd-coinUSDC(USDC)$1.00
  • dogecoinDogecoin(DOGE)$0.221661
  • cardanoCardano(ADA)$0.77
  • tronTRON(TRX)$0.273940

Web3InsightsWeb3Insights
Font ResizerAa
  • Home
  • Crypto
  • Market
  • News
  • Blockchain
Search
  • News
  • Bitcoin
  • Cryptocurrency
  • DeFi
  • NFT
  • Web3
  • Tutorials
  • Bookmarks
    • My Bookmarks
    • Customize Interests
Have an existing account? Sign In
Follow US
© Web3insights. 2023
Web3Insights > Blog > Blockchain > AI Agents > Building AI Agents for Web3: A Step-by-Step Guide
AI AgentsBlockchainCrypto

Building AI Agents for Web3: A Step-by-Step Guide

Creator Admin
Last updated: 2025/02/06 at 9:14 AM
Creator Admin Published February 6, 2025
Share
AI Agents

AI agents are at the forefront of technological innovation, transforming industries by automating complex tasks. Combined with Web3, the decentralized and blockchain-driven internet, these agents open up limitless possibilities. From optimizing decentralized finance (DeFi) to streamlining NFT investments, building AI agents tailored for Web3 is an exciting and impactful venture. 

Contents
Overview of Building AI Agents for Web3Tools and Technologies You’ll NeedStep-by-Step Guide to Building AI AgentsStep 1: Define Your AI Agent’s PurposeStep 2: Choose the Right Tools and FrameworksStep 3: Prepare Your DataStep 4: Develop Your AI AgentStep 5: Deploy and MonitorReal-World Applications of AI Agents Conclusion

This guide will walk you through the process in a clear, conversational style, making it easier to understand and implement.

Overview of Building AI Agents for Web3

AI Agents

Creating AI agents for Web3 projects requires blending artificial intelligence and blockchain technology. Let’s break it down into manageable steps, covering essential tools, frameworks, and strategies to make the journey accessible for beginners.

First, what are AI agents? Simply put, they are smart systems capable of analyzing data, making decisions, and performing tasks independently. When integrated into the Web3 ecosystem, these agents can do things like automate repetitive tasks, improve user experiences, and even optimize decentralized applications (dApps).

To get started, keep two key concepts in mind:

  1. Autonomy: Your AI agent should operate independently, making decisions without needing your constant input.
  2. Integration with Web3: It should use blockchain technology for transparency and security, enabling advanced features like automated trading or interacting with smart contracts.

Tools and Technologies You’ll Need

AI Agents

Building an AI agent requires some groundwork. You’ll need tools for AI and blockchain development. Here’s a quick overview:

  • AI Frameworks: Tools like TensorFlow or PyTorch help create machine learning models for your agent.
  • Blockchain Tools: Platforms like Hardhat, Truffle, or Remix let you create and deploy smart contracts.
  • Oracles and Data Providers: Services like Chainlink or The Graph fetch real-time blockchain data for your agent.
  • Programming Languages: Python is a favorite for AI, while Solidity is key for smart contracts.
  • Web3 Libraries: Tools like Ethers.js or Web3.js connect your agent to the blockchain.

Step-by-Step Guide to Building AI Agents

AI Agents

Let’s dive into the steps in a practical and approachable way. Each step will help you bring your AI agent idea to life.

Step 1: Define Your AI Agent’s Purpose

AI Agents

Start by asking yourself: What exactly do I want this agent to do? For example, is it going to act as a trading bot, help users curate NFTs, or assist with governance in a decentralized autonomous organization (DAO)?

  • Identify Needs: Think about the specific problems you want your agent to solve. For instance, an NFT curator could analyze trends to identify hidden gems in the market.
  • Set Objectives: Be clear about the goals. Do you want to optimize transactions? Improve user interactions? Manage digital assets more effectively?

Defining the purpose is crucial because it sets the stage for all the following steps.

Step 2: Choose the Right Tools and Frameworks

AI Agents

Selecting the right tools can make or break your project. Here’s a closer look:

  • LangChain: This is perfect for linking AI models to blockchain data and creating workflows for complex tasks. While it’s powerful, it may take some time to master.
  • AutoGen: If you’re just starting, this tool from Microsoft simplifies the process with a conversational coding interface. Great for quick prototypes!
  • Eternal AI: This tool lets you integrate AI agents directly into blockchain environments, even turning NFTs into intelligent agents.

For non-coders, no-code platforms like BUILD are a lifesaver. They allow you to create basic agents without writing a single line of code.

Step 3: Prepare Your Data

AI agents thrive on data, so this step is critical:

  • Collect Data: Gather both on-chain data (e.g., transactions, smart contract interactions) and off-chain data (e.g., market trends, social sentiment).
  • Clean and Organize: Remove duplicates or irrelevant data and make sure everything is formatted consistently. Clean data ensures better AI performance.

Step 4: Develop Your AI Agent

This is where your agent starts to come to life. Don’t worry, it’s less intimidating than it sounds!

  • Pick a Model: Choose an AI model that suits your needs. Pre-trained models from OpenAI or Hugging Face are good starting points.
  • Customize the Model: Fine-tune the model so it understands blockchain-specific data. For example, train it to recognize trends in NFT marketplaces.
  • Build Interactions: Integrate your agent with smart contracts, ensuring it can autonomously execute tasks like transferring funds or triggering events on the blockchain.
  • Test Thoroughly: Before deploying your agent, simulate its behavior in test environments. For blockchain tasks, use testnets to avoid risks with real assets.

Step 5: Deploy and Monitor

You’re almost there! Now it’s time to launch your AI agent and make it operational.

  • Hosting Choices: Decide where your agent will live. Cloud platforms like AWS or decentralized solutions like Akash Network are popular options.
  • Connect to APIs: Integrate your agent with Web3 tools through APIs to enable seamless functionality.
  • Prioritize Security: Ensure robust authentication to protect users’ data and transactions. If possible, incorporate privacy technologies like zero-knowledge proofs.

Once deployed, monitor your agent’s performance and tweak it as needed to ensure it’s meeting its objectives.

Real-World Applications of AI Agents

AI agents in Web3 are already making waves, and the possibilities continue to grow. Let’s dive into some exciting real-world use cases:

  • Trading Bots: Imagine a bot that not only automates crypto and NFT trading but learns from market behavior to optimize buy and sell strategies. These bots analyze market trends, track token performance, and make decisions in real-time.
  • Rarity Analyzers for NFTs: If you’re diving into NFTs, an AI agent can sift through metadata, rarity scores, and market trends to identify undervalued assets. This can save hours of manual research and help you spot hidden gems.
  • DAO Assistants: Governance in decentralized autonomous organizations often involves analyzing proposals and voting data. AI agents can review proposals, assess community sentiment, and provide actionable insights to DAO members.
  • Play-to-Earn Game Enhancers: In blockchain gaming, AI agents can help players maximize earnings by automating repetitive tasks, identifying lucrative in-game assets, or even optimizing gameplay strategies.
  • Decentralized Identity Verification: AI agents can enhance security by automating identity checks in a decentralized manner. For example, they can validate user credentials without compromising privacy, a vital feature in Web3 ecosystems.

Conclusion

Building AI agents tailored for Web3 projects doesn’t have to be daunting. By taking it step by step, anyone can create intelligent systems that bring value to decentralized ecosystems. Whether you’re a seasoned developer or a beginner, the key is to start small, stay curious, and continuously improve your skills. The Web3 space is evolving rapidly, there’s no better time to dive in and start building!

You Might Also Like

How Do Stablecoins Work? Breaking Down the Tech

Stablecoins vs Cryptocurrencies: What’s the Real Difference?

What Are Stablecoins? A Simple Guide to the Future of Money

Bitcoin on Solana vs Bitcoin on Ethereum: What’s the Difference?

Bitcoin on Solana: Top Interoperability Protocols Making It Possible

TAGGED: AI Agents, DeFi, Web3

Sign Up For Daily Newsletter

Be keep up! Get the latest breaking news delivered straight to your inbox.
By signing up, you agree to our Terms of Use and acknowledge the data practices in our Privacy Policy. You may unsubscribe at any time.
Creator Admin February 6, 2025 February 6, 2025
Share This Article
Facebook Twitter Email Copy Link Print
Previous Article AI Agents: Leveraging Intelligence for Smarter NFT Investment
Next Article AI Agents vs. Bots: Understanding the Differences in the Web3
Leave a comment

Leave a Reply Cancel reply

You must be logged in to post a comment.

Follow US

Find US on Socials
Twitter Follow
Pinterest Pin
Youtube Subscribe
Telegram Follow

Subscribe to our newslettern

Get Newest Articles Instantly!

Popular News
Investing in Bitcoin Without FOMO: A 10-Step Guide
7 Easy Steps: How to Dive into DeFi Investment as a Newbie 🚀
Bitcoin Price: Is it too late to buy?

Follow Us on Socials

We use social media to react to breaking news, update supporters and share information

Twitter Youtube Telegram Linkedin
Web3Insights

We influence 20 million users and is the number one business blockchain and crypto news network on the planet.

Subscribe to our newsletter

You can be the first to find out the latest news and tips about trading, markets...

© Web3insights. 2024
Welcome Back!

Sign in to your account

Lost your password?